293 equal divisions of the tritave, perfect twelfth, or 3rd harmonic (abbreviated 293edt or 293ed3), is a nonoctave tuning system that divides the interval of 3/1 into 293 equal parts of about 6.49 ¢ each. Each step represents a frequency ratio of 31/293, or the 293rd root of 3.
